Scores approach temps on hot, windy day on the links

Nick Tianello

MASSILLON, Ohio -- Rocky River competed in the Polar Bear Invitational at Shady Hollow Country Club Monday. The Pirates placed 15th against a challenging field on a warm and windy day, as they opened their second week of the season.

Leading River was Lucas Dietrich who fired an 11-over 83 on the 6,799-yard track. Dietrich carded a 39 on the front nine and a 44 on the back. He was joined on the four-man totals sheet by Owen Toole (87), Wes Bennett (87), and Sam Vannucci (88).

Highlights on the day included birdies for Nick Tianello, Toole, and Vannucci.

Hoban fired a 291 to win the tournament which was hosted by Massillon Jackson High School. St. Ignatius was runner-up at 293. Ashland's Tyler Sabo carded a 68 to earn medalist honors.

The Pirates are slated to play in another invitational tournament on Tuesday when they travel to Redtail Golf Club in Avon for the St. Ignatius Invitational.
